EMT Valencia's Electric Bus Initiative: A Green Revolution in Public Transport

Modern Valencia electric buses outside futuristic architecture

Valencia’s Move Towards Sustainability with Electric Buses

In a significant step towards enhancing urban public transportation, EMT Valencia has added 26 electric buses to its fleet. This initiative highlights the growing trend of cities prioritizing green energy solutions and aligns perfectly with global movements aimed at reducing carbon footprints and promoting sustainable living.

The Importance of Electric Public Transportation

Electric buses play a crucial role in the transition towards more sustainable urban transport. Unlike conventional buses that rely on fossil fuels, electric vehicles produce zero emissions during operation, directly contributing to improved air quality and reduced greenhouse gas emissions. Such advancements are paramount in urban centers, where pollution often reaches critical levels due to heavy traffic.

Technological Advancements in Electric Vehicles

The electric buses introduced by EMT Valencia represent the latest in EV technology, offering not just environmental benefits but also enhanced efficiencies in daily operations. These buses typically have lower operating costs compared to their diesel counterparts due to decreased fuel and maintenance expenses. As technology continues to advance, we can expect further developments in bus battery systems, resulting in longer range and faster charging capabilities.

Zest's Vision: Transforming Thurrock with 4,000 New Charge Points

Update The Future of Charging Stations in Thurrock: A New EraIn a significant infrastructure initiative, the Thurrock Council has contracted Zest to roll out more than 4,000 electric vehicle (EV) charge points across the borough, positioning itself as a frontrunner in the UK's transition to electric mobility. This strategy is not merely about installing charging stations; it reflects a broader commitment to enhancing green energy solutions and supporting the local economy.Understanding the Infrastructure PlanThe installation plan encompasses various charging solutions, including lamp-post chargers as well as AC and DC charging points. The strategic selection of locations prioritizes areas currently underserved by public charging facilities, ensuring accessibility for on-street households and promoting an equitable charging environment. Importantly, Zest will assume responsibility for the majority of the installation costs, covering around 98% of the expenses, a bold move supported by the UK Government's Local Electric Vehicle Infrastructure (LEVI) fund.Community and Economic BenefitsThurrock is recognized as a vital economic corridor for the greater London region. Home to major logistics hubs such as the Port of Tilbury and London Gateway, the expansion of EV infrastructure is poised to support both local communities and broader regional economic activities. As Robin Heap, CEO of Zest, stated, this partnership underscores the importance of creating a reliable and sustainable charging network that caters to community needs while bolstering economic resilience.Why This Matters to Homeowners and BusinessesFor homeowners and businesses interested in harnessing solar and green energy, this initiative presents a unique opportunity. With the increasing adoption of electric vehicles, the demand for robust charging infrastructure will only grow. Homeowners contemplating the installation of solar-powered home charging stations can benefit from the added convenience of having nearby public charging points, enhancing grid independence and encouraging the broader use of renewable energy options.Future Opportunities with Renewable EnergyThe integration of extensive charging points aligns seamlessly with the rise of solar energy technologies and infrastructure. As households increasingly adopt solar power, the provision of EV charging solutions at their convenience at public locations can significantly augment their energy independence. The expansion of this charging network serves as a catalyst for local businesses to adapt and embrace electric vehicles, thus enriching the local green economy while reducing carbon emissions.Challenges and ConsiderationsDespite the seemingly straightforward rollout, challenges lie ahead. Regulatory hurdles, site selection complexities, and infrastructure deployment can prove daunting. Ensuring that charging points are situated strategically within the community while catering to both demand and availability will require ongoing analysis and community engagement. Additionally, Zest's commitment to maintaining these chargers over a 15-year horizon brings its own set of accountability and service standards.Conclusion and Moving ForwardThurrock's ambitious project to install over 4,000 charge points serves not just as a response to the rising tide of electric vehicle adoption but embodies the community's larger commitment to sustainability. Are EVs More Expensive than Gas Cars? The Real Cost Analysis

Update EVs vs. Gas Cars: A Shifting Perspective on Costs As electric vehicles (EVs) continue to infiltrate the automotive market, many potential buyers are left wondering whether they can afford what appears to be a premium. The prevailing notion suggests that EVs come with a hefty price tag compared to gas-powered vehicles. However, insights from industry experts hint that this stereotype may no longer hold true.In 'Are EVs more expensive than gas cars?', the discussion dives into the cost comparison between electric and gasoline vehicles, shedding light on key insights that sparked deeper analysis on our end. Recent Trends in EV Affordability According to Tom Bowen from Qmerit, the cost narrative surrounding EVs has significantly changed since 2021. With a plethora of new models hitting the market, including the Chevy Bolt and a soon-to-be-launched Ford truck set to start at $30,000, EVs are becoming increasingly accessible. Current offerings reflect minimal differences in price—take the 2025 Chevrolet Equinox at just under $30,000 compared to the Equinox EV starting at around $32,000. That’s merely a $2,000 difference, and contextually, it's a drop in the bucket when the average new car price hovers closer to $48,000. Understanding the Total Cost of Ownership The initial sticker price of an EV can be offset by numerous financial incentives offered by local and state governments. Moreover, when evaluating the total cost of ownership, studies reveal that many EVs cost less over their lifespans when compared to their gasoline counterparts. An important takeaway from various analyses indicates that many smaller or lower-range EVs actually yield better cost-saving returns, with break-even points typically falling between 2 to 3 years. Long-Term Financial Benefits for Drivers Experts who've transitioned to electric driving report substantial savings—not just from purchasing an EV, but also from ongoing operational costs. Notably, a Rivian owner shared that they incurred zero maintenance expenses aside from a minor $15 windshield wiper fluid purchase over three years. This contrasts sharply with the general upkeep costs associated with gas vehicles, making the case for long-range EV ownership even stronger. Fuel Efficiency and Charging: A Close Look Electricity prices may fluctuate, but charging at home often remains cost-effective. Tom Moloughney points out that as long as the majority of charging occurs at home, drivers will reap the benefits. Public fast chargers may bring costs in line with gasoline, but with the right setup and strategies, the savings can be remarkable. Those with solar systems and battery setups further amplify their potentials for financial gain through sustainable energy use. Conclusion: Rethinking the Cost Debate The notion that EVs are categorically more expensive than gas cars no longer holds water. With more affordable models, a range of financial incentives, and reduced maintenance needs, the economic landscape is shifting in favor of electric transportation. With significant investments from major manufacturers announcing commitments to affordability, the future of driving is green—and increasingly cost-effective. Exploring GAC Aion's RT Super: The Future of EV Swappable Batteries

Update GAC Aion's Revolutionary EV: The Aion RT Super In an exciting leap forward for electric vehicles (EVs), GAC Aion has recently launched the Aion RT Super, a battery-electric saloon equipped with cutting-edge, swappable battery technology developed by CATL. The Aion RT Super not only enhances the driving experience but also aims to redefine how we think about EV infrastructure. What Makes the Aion RT Super Stand Out? The Aion RT Super enters the market equipped with a 54 kWh lithium iron phosphate (LFP) battery from CATL, designed for seamless integration with China’s expanding battery swap networks. This electric sedan, measuring **4.87 meters in length**, can achieve a full battery swap in just **99 seconds**, significantly reducing downtime compared to traditional charging methods. Furthermore, the vehicle boasts a commendable range of **up to 505 kilometers** on a single charge, establishing itself as a competitive option in the EV segment. Cost Structure: A Game Changer for Consumers Notably, the Aion RT Super is priced at **88,800 yuan** (approximately **€11,050**), excluding the battery itself. This pricing strategy is designed to lower the initial financial barrier for consumers. Instead of owning the battery, buyers will lease it through a subscription model at a cost of **399 yuan** (around **$58**) per month. This move parallels the approach taken by competing brands like Nio, which offers customers a choice between leasing and purchasing the battery outright. Infrastructure and Future Growth The introduction of the Aion RT Super and its advanced battery swapping technology aligns with CATL's ambitious goal to establish **30,000 battery swap stations** across China by 2030. Currently, the company is rapidly expanding its **Choco Swap Network**, aiming to have **over 3,000 stations operational** by the end of 2026. This infrastructure will not only boost the adoption of EVs but will also support a more sustainable and efficient energy ecosystem. Broader Implications for the EV Market The Aion RT Super is part of a broader trend where automakers are increasingly focusing on creating flexible, user-friendly solutions for urban transportation. By decentralizing battery ownership, manufacturers like GAC Aion are taking significant steps towards an accessible and versatile electric future. The separation of the vehicle and battery ownership also encourages longer-term investment in EV technology, making it more appealing to a wider audience. Moreover, the rapid scaling of battery swap infrastructure is likely to invite competitors into the market, thereby accelerating the development of alternative energy solutions. Other manufacturers, including BAIC and Xpeng, are expected to follow suit soon, driven by the demand for efficient, sustainable transportation models.
